Welcome to Harris ...

The town of Harris is located in Sullivan County<1>.


The location of Harris has been provided by the Geographic Names Information System (ie- the GNIS).<2>


While we don't have a date for the founding of Harris, you might consider that their post office opened  in 1887.

From the  Census Estimates for 2019, Harris has a population of 55 people<3> (see below for details).

Harris is 890 feet [271 m] above sea level.<4>.

Time Zone: Harris lies in the Central Time Zone (CST/CDT) and observes daylight saving time

The area code for Harris: (660)

The ZIP code for Harris: 64645<5>

Population Details ...

Taken from the 2019 Census Estimates, Harris had an population of 55 people. This is a decrease of 9.84% since the 2010 Census (or a decrease of 47.62% since the 2000 Census).

At the time of the 2010 Census, Harris had a population of 61 people. This makes Harris the county's 7th most populous community.

With a 2010 count of 61 people, the population of Harris decreased 41.9% from the 2000 Census (which had a count of 105 people).

Adding Harris to Our Gazetteer ...

We originally found mention of Harris in both the FIPS-55 and the GNIS. For more information, see the FIPS and GNIS Codes sections on our Miscellaneous Page.

From our notes, the earliest published mention we've found for Harris was in the document titled List of Post Offices from Cameron Blevins and Richard Helbock.<7>

From that list, the Harris post office opened in 1887.

We also found Harris in the book titled Business Atlas and Shippers' Guide (1895).
